Transaction Code: KSW5
Description: Execute Actual Periodic Reposting
Release: S/4HANA and ECC 6
Menu Path:
Program: SAPMKGA2
Screen: 101
Authorization Object:
Development Package: KALC
Package Description: Cost Accounting allocations RK-S
Parent Package: APPL
Module/Component: CO-OM-CCA
Description: Cost Center Accounting
Overview: The SAP transaction code KSW5 is used to execute actual periodic reposting. This transaction code is used to post the actual costs of a period to the cost center or order.
